One of the best known species of crocodiles is the Nile crocodile, reptiles that have lived in the water for centuries and have been known since ancient Egypt. These reptiles can reach enormous sizes, reaching five meters in length and weighing close to a ton, however there are reports of individuals that exceeded these measurements, weighing almost 1,100 kilograms and over six meters in length. The Nile crocodile is seen as the largest freshwater predator in Africa and is a real nightmare for many other species. But despite being such a feared reptile, it doesn't mean they don't have animals that can hurt them. As shown in this video which shows a poor crocodile being attacked by a large elephant. Elephants rarely fight crocodiles, however, mothers are fiercely protective of their young and male elephants can be hostile during mating.
